Calling All Property Managers!
Join the WRAR Property Management Council at their next meeting on November 14 at 9AM in the Conference Room at 1826 Sir Tyler Dr. Come meet your peers and discuss problems and find solutions - you're are not alone. As of October 1, there is a law allowing partial payment of rent which may still be the basis for proceeding with eviction rather than requiring the eviction to stop - a win for property managers and owners. SUPRA

ActiveKEY Dead Battery
If the ActiveKEY battery will not turn on or make any sounds and will not take a charge when plugged in, it probably has not been charged for an extended period of time. Plug in the ActiveKEY & perform a reset with the power plugged in and then charge it for 8 hours to completely recharge it.
